Опережающий ввод текста в Твиттере на сенсорных устройствах — как обстоят дела сейчас?

Поэтому в своих собственных документах они пишут, что "мобильные браузеры не тестировались" и есть несколько сообщений об ошибках, в которых упоминается, что мобильные браузеры не поддерживаются (что не совсем то же самое, что просто «не проверено»). Однако в другом сообщении об ошибке говорится, что он совместим с большинством браузеров.

Мы включили twitter typeahead 10.5.0 в наш проект, и я не могу заставить его работать ни на одной версии/устройстве/браузере iOS, даже несмотря на то, что он, кажется, работает на странице примера twitter (которая могла бы реализовать обходной путь), так что облом . Я довольно разъярен тем, что не могу найти ничего в сети об обходном пути для поддержки сенсорных устройств, например, четкого утверждения, какие устройства действительно должны работать, и/или нескольких чистых примеров кода на как поддерживать сенсорный ввод в twitter.

Итак, я спрашиваю вас, ребята, кто-нибудь знает, если и на каких устройствах это должно работать, и, может быть, есть совет, как заставить его работать на сенсорном экране? Я знаю, что мог бы «просто» добавить несколько пользовательских сенсорных событий в элементы typeahead и выполнить то же самое, что и в typeahead:selected, но я действительно очень надеюсь, что есть более чистый способ с использованием их событий/API...


person Simon    schedule 27.04.2015    source источник


Ответы (1)


Итак, видимо, это ошибка с typeahead и fastclick.js, которая была представлена ​​в typeahead 0.10.2., поэтому мне нужно было перейти на версию 0.10.1 (обновление до 0.11 сломало нашу текущую настройку).

person Simon    schedule 08.05.2015